Output 86fe0e99580cc5156d1d21b816076876526c6f619e7d285fb883e1ee2f11afa2:0

value
6628283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47e826c1bae1ed8ad9da2f4fb44a074712261d2a OP_EQUAL
address
38FE1KpdcqsVwwejm328VxMMKduWkvBA6t
transaction
86fe0e99580cc5156d1d21b816076876526c6f619e7d285fb883e1ee2f11afa2
spent
true